(Dak, Pickens and the Cowboys shock the Eagles in Jerry World with 21 Point Comeback to split season Series)

USATSI_21714449.567c056c.fill-735x490.jpg

(After an Explosive 1st half the Eagles Offense went conservative and was shut out in the 2nd half. AJ Brown had one of his best performances)

6924ebcc2e524.image.jpg

(Sirianni gets the heat from Fans and Media as his OC Hire Kevin Patullo continues to face criticism for the Offensive Issues)


*The Philadelphia Eagles fall to 8-3 on the season. This matches the combined loss total for all of last year. Cowboys still lead the All Time Series 75-59. They still lead the NFC BEAST by 3 games but fall to #2 in the Conference after the Rams beat the Bucs. Eagles lose in their Kelly Green Retro Jersey for the first time and fall to 4-1.

*ADVERSITY ONLY SHOWS WHO YOU REALLY ARE: After a week full of Drama, Jalen Hurts loses his 3rd start over the last 25 games. He passed for a season high 39 attempts. Jalen Hurts still leads the league with only 1 interception on the season.

*ASCENDING AJ: AJ Brown had one of his best games of the season with over 100 yards and TD.

*DICING DEFENSE: After a shutting out the Cowboys most of the 1st half, the Defense struggled to stop Dak and Pickens in the 2nd Half

*CONSERVATIVE COACHING: Sirianni and Patullo played that game not to lose. The Eagles Offense went way to conservative in the 2nd half.

*RUN THE BALL: The Eagles rushed for a season low 17 total carries. Saquon only had 10 carries in the game.

*TURNOVER TROUBLE: Saquon fumbles for the first time of the season. Special Teams also cost a fumble. The Eagles have the lowest turnovers in the entire league.

*HOLDING THE LINE: The O-Line is getting heat for injuries and constant rotations that hasn't been as strong as previous years.


*AS THE NFC BEAST TURNS: The Boys saved their season with their Comeback win against the Eagles in Jerry World. They remain in 2nd Place at 5-5-1. Washington was on a Bye Week and play the Broncos this week they are in 3rd Place at 3-8. The GMen went to the wire with the Lions but lost in overtime to fall to 2-10. The GMen became the 1st team of the NFL Season to be eliminated from Playoff Contention. The Eagles remain #1 at 8-3.
